I'm so thrilled to share the dorm design I created with The Home Depot for their summer catalog – a room I produced with their incredible styling team from scratch. Inspired by the old buildings which housed my dorms at Cornell, the room features a vintage-style window – although in contrast to my old dorms, this room has a beautiful city view! The design features a mix of modern and traditional style, layered with pattern and pops of color to bring the space to life in a cozy setting.
I chose a map wall tapestry, tufted headboard, and a white nightstand with a stylish x-detail. A blue storage bench provides style and function at the end of the bed, and a faux cowhide is layered on top of a practical patterned area rug. The workspace features a modern desk and bookshelf from the Donnelly collection and a mirror on the wall to provide a built-in vanity station.
